Here is Some Good Information About GED Tutoring

The GED is also referred to as a General Education Diploma. Looking for help? Select a tutor today. In addition to English, the GED tests are available in Spanish, French, large print, audiocassette, and braille. Tests and test preparation are routinely offered in prisons and on military bases in addition to more traditional settings. Need help? Select a tutor now. Need to pass the GED?
